Output 2c07c9546c7c1d8f2deaedfc0045092ff3716dfbb30324e24ccd9af03dbd2ddf:1

value
5388462
script pubkey
OP_0 OP_PUSHBYTES_20 95fbec0fc66f6f3dc5c208c31d237cc7777361b3
address
bc1qjha7cr7xdahnm3wzprp36gmucamhxcdnwfn87r
transaction
2c07c9546c7c1d8f2deaedfc0045092ff3716dfbb30324e24ccd9af03dbd2ddf
confirmations
154425
spent
true